Abstract

"Process for obtaining monoglycol ester of terephthalic acid", characterized in that in an aqueous suspension of acid alkaline salts of terephthalic acid, under normal or high pressure and at temperatures between 60 and 250º C, ethylene oxide is introduced until that the pH of the reaction mixture is 7-9, an acid which is more acidic than the monoglycolic ester of terephthalic acid is added to this reaction mixture, and the monoglycolic ester of terephthalic acid is removed.
